Three teens were injured in a shooting in north Charlotte early Tuesday morning.

The shooting happened in the 1700 block of Russell Avenue just before 1 a.m. Charlotte-Mecklenburg police said once officers arrived at the scene, they found three teens who had been shot outside a home.

At least one teen has serious injuries, police say. All three were hospitalized at Carolinas Medical Center.

The extent of their injuries is unknown. Police say witnesses are not cooperating with the investigation so there are little to no details on the alleged shooters. No one has been arrested.
